Output 34c59f9231c41b6123fefaf01e6cd16e556d51f6b77f2dc6150a3ab5890dbc45:54

value
1839944
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 affb2e0a6f5c5685c71a12a2ec056931eac9f3f8 OP_EQUALVERIFY OP_CHECKSIG
address
1H3W9rRErkpFMgh48eKXQFXNaHUY2VDFZy
transaction
34c59f9231c41b6123fefaf01e6cd16e556d51f6b77f2dc6150a3ab5890dbc45
confirmations
192726
spent
true